Subject: On-call intro — Fabrikit test-data factory

Welcome to the rotation, Daro. Most of our integration suites seed fixtures through Fabrikit, our internal test-data factory library. If a suite fails on seeding, check the factory traits before blaming the service. Mira covered common gotchas at last week's sync. The runbook and trait catalog live on the internal page here.

runbook for badug-kadup: https://confluence.zemvarlabs.internal/projects/browse/display/projects/bd1b

Ticket: config drift on Sweepline, our orphaned-resource sweeper. Prod and staging have quietly diverged again — staging is deleting detached volumes after 3 days, prod after 14, and nobody remembers deciding that. Tova noticed when the Harkness cluster cleanup ran early. We should pin these in the Fernwald repo instead of hand-editing. For reference, here's what prod is actually running with right now.

deployment values, yagaf-tawif:
[zorael]
team = pelix
access_code = ac_be383e
host = zorael.tolvaqio.internal
port = 8080
owner = druath.ulador
peer = fendor.tolvaqcorp.corp

Hi dispatch — quick one. The pallet of recalled Brightvolt chargers is wrapped and tagged in Bay 2, ready for the carrier pickup tomorrow morning. Paperwork's taped to the top carton. Please make sure whoever's coordinating the driver knows it can't be split or restacked. Pass the driver the hand-over instruction below exactly as written.

dispatch memo: the lamwyn fenwyn courier leaves the wenir ledger at gate 7175 under passcode 822969

## Orphan Sweeper Environments

The Tidewell platform runs an orphaned-resource sweeper in every environment, reclaiming volumes and stale plugin sandboxes left behind by failed installs. Plugin authors should assume the sweeper may delete unreferenced artifacts after the grace window. The sweeper's effective configuration in the sandbox environment is shown below.

config for kafof-bawef:
holath:
  log_level: debug
  metrics_host: metrics.holath.qorvelsys.internal
  pin: 2191
  pool_size: 32